FRESNO WINTER SECTIONAL

PRESIDENT’S DAY WEKEND
February 17-20, 2017
     We’re doing things a little bit different this year. We’re ending the sectional on Monday, President’s Day. Most of the schedule is the same as usual, except that the tournament starts on Friday instead of Thursday. Friday has open and 499er games at 9 am and 1:30 p.m., plus Fast Pairs at 6 pm. Saturday morning at 10 am has a 199er game and on open game. Members with under 10 points play free on Saturday morning. All other games have open and 499er sections. Swiss teams are on Sunday as usual. Check the flyer for game times on Sunday and Monday. Life Masters may play in the 499er games as long as they have under 500 points. REPORT from the JUDICIARY CHAIR
By Don Austin
As some of you may know, Unit 522 had to convene a judiciary hearing last year. A player was… well the only way to say it is that this player was rude. This involved a violation of the ACBL rules of conduct. The player has been suspended from play in all ACBL events for 30 days.
The Board of Directors has long been discussing ways to improve the temperament of our games.  One of the complaints about showing traveling scores on the bridge pads was that players would gloat about winning hands as the game progressed. Some players stopped playing at the club because they did not like even this level of rudeness. Additionally, we consistently hear from beginning players that they are intimidated by advanced players in open games; not so much from the better play, but by some less than gracious players.
If we want to keep this center alive, we must encourage new and continuing players by being kind and friendly.
So let’s make it our practice: when new (and well known) players come to your table, please greet them nicely. When the dummy’s hands come down, say thank you. When the round is over, complement your opponents and thank them for the game.
If someone is rude, tell the director, either immediately or between rounds, depending on the severity.  Of course, if there is a question of play, call the director immediately; but PLEASE BE NICE.  If you have questions about the ACBL rules of conduct, check out the ACBL Code of Disciplinary Regulations (CDR) on the ACBL Website. I will also try to answer any questions you might have.

DISTRICT 21
Those who qualified for the NAP finals may play in Mountain View or Burlingame. Flight A plays in Mountain View on January 21 and 22. Flight C plays on January 22. Flight B plays in Burlingame on Saturday, February 4.
               Grand National Team play starts February 11 and 12 for the Open Flight and Flight C, with pre-registration due on February 1.  Flight B stars in March. Flight A starts in April. All flights require only preregistration. See the District 21 website for more information.
